Transaction 8b5043d791fbefb8d20482be1703f73ecd63098c27a1080fb8e6380ae6aee896

1 Input
2 Outputs
  • 8b5043d791fbefb8d20482be1703f73ecd63098c27a1080fb8e6380ae6aee896:0
  • value  223291
    address  328yFsSKnWoxjAjVLV37RcpsRHyow5Bpay
  • 8b5043d791fbefb8d20482be1703f73ecd63098c27a1080fb8e6380ae6aee896:1
  • value  17085960
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d